>> Hello,
>> I ran the selfupdate command a few days ago and now whenever I try
>> to do
>> anything with Fink, I get:
>>
>> Failed: The package full name 'fondu-030428-1' is not allowed to be
>> used
>> more than once. at /sw/lib/perl5/Fink/Package.pm line 142.
>>
>> Followed by the prompt at the terminal. It does not want to do
>> anything now
>> except give the above warning. It looks to me that in the selfupdate
>> process, something has become corrupted. I tried looking at
>> /sw/lib/perl5/Fink/Package.pm line 142, but it is a Perl script file
>> and
>> does not contain a list of files. Any ideas? Thanks in advance.
>>
>> Walter Hofmeister
>>
> try
>
> sudo rm -rf /sw/fink/10.3/unstable/main/finkinfo/utils/fondu.info
>
> and then do another selfupdate---that's the most likely thing to be
> corrupted.
Hi Alexander,
I tried your suggestion and it attempted to do a selfupdate but then
when it tried to update the database, it gave the same warning. It then did
the same as before (just gives the warning).
